While many of the wind slabs that formed during the storm have become slightly more difficult to trigger, human triggering of these slabs remains possible. Stepping on or riding over trigger points or having more than one person on a slope would make triggering these wind slabs easier. In addition to the wind slabs that formed on the N-NE-E aspects during the storm, new wind slabs may have started to form on the opposite aspects (W-SW-S) since the winds have shifted to the north and east. These new wind slabs will remain smaller, but more sensitive than the older ones. The NW and SE aspects get cross loaded with both wind directions. Wind slabs could exist on any exposed near and above treeline aspects today. Most avalanches that result from the failure of these wind slabs should fail at or above the old snow surface; however, some of them could step down into older snow layers in areas where the wind slabs exist on top of old hard slabs on the NW-N-NE aspects. Avalanches involving wind slabs could entrain enough snow to bury a person.
Cornices above a slope, wind ripples, drifts, blowing snow, and other signs of wind loading can all serve as clues to help recognize slopes where wind slabs may exist. If a near or above treeline area looks nicely filled in and smooth and rounded, wind slabs likely exist in that area. Complex or extreme terrain like couliors and unsupported slopes will hold unstable wind slabs longer than other terrain and also have more potential consequences.
